Gov''t to Install 38 MWh Battery Energy Storage System in 18 Islands
The installation of the 38 MWh battery energy storage system will enable the connection of additional solar photovoltaic (PV) capacity to the grid, while also supporting grid stabilisation.

18 islands to get battery storage under new energy project
Under the project, battery systems ranging from 500 kilowatt-hours (kWh) to 3,000 kWh will be installed on selected islands, allowing for more solar PV integration and grid stability.
